Care Package Ideas for Comfort and Self-Care

Comfort-focused care packages are ideal for someone who’s feeling overwhelmed, unwell, or emotionally drained. These packages should encourage rest, relaxation, and kindness toward oneself.

Consider including cozy items like soft socks, a warm scarf, or a sleep mask. Self-care essentials such as herbal teas, bath products, scented candles, or skincare items can help create moments of calm. Add a comforting snack or two, like chocolate, biscuits, or soup mixes, to round things out.

A small journal or affirmation card can gently encourage reflection and mindfulness. The goal is to create a care package that feels like a warm hug, reminding the recipient to slow down and take care of themselves.

Care Package Ideas for Students

Students often appreciate care packages that combine practicality with encouragement. Whether they’re studying away from home, preparing for exams, or starting university, a care package can provide both emotional support and useful supplies.

Include snacks that are easy to store and eat while studying, such as muesli bars, trail mix, or instant meals. Study aids like highlighters, sticky notes, or planners can help them stay organised. Motivational notes, inspirational quotes, or reminders to take breaks can also make a big difference during stressful periods.

Adding a few fun items, like stickers or novelty socks, keeps the package from feeling too serious and adds an element of joy.

Care Package Ideas for Long-Distance Relationships

Long-distance care package ideas should focus on connection. Items that remind the recipient of you or your shared bond help bridge the physical gap. This might include matching items, such as mugs or bracelets, or objects tied to shared experiences.

Scent can be surprisingly powerful, so including a candle or product with a familiar fragrance can create a sense of closeness. Letters or printed messages can be especially meaningful in long-distance situations, offering something tangible to hold onto.

You can also include activities you can do together from afar, such as a book you’re both reading or a game you can play online at the same time.

Care Package Ideas for Tough Times

During difficult moments, care packages can offer quiet support without demanding anything in return. The key is sensitivity. Avoid overly cheerful items if the recipient is grieving or struggling, and focus instead on comfort and reassurance.

Simple, nourishing snacks, soothing teas, and gentle self-care products work well. A thoughtful note acknowledging their feelings, without trying to fix them, can be incredibly powerful. Sometimes, just knowing someone cares is enough.

It’s also helpful to include practical items that make daily life a little easier, such as ready-to-eat food or household essentials, especially when energy levels are low.

Creative and Themed Care Package Ideas

Themed care packages can be a fun way to bring everything together. A movie night theme might include popcorn, lollies, a cozy blanket, and a handwritten movie recommendation list. A “bad day” care package could feature comfort snacks, a candle, uplifting quotes, and a playlist suggestion written on a card.

Seasonal themes also work well. A winter care package might focus on warmth and coziness, while a summer one could include refreshing treats and outdoor essentials. Themes help guide your choices and give the package a cohesive feel.
